Perfect Square
810133361525765990211571552737031896295584738144923000976 is a perfect square (28462841768273349803128077324 × 28462841768273349803128077324)
810133361525765990211571552737031896295584738144923000976 is a perfect square (28462841768273349803128077324 × 28462841768273349803128077324)
810133361525765990211571552737031896295584738144923000976 is even
Previous even number is 810133361525765990211571552737031896295584738144923000974
Next even number is 810133361525765990211571552737031896295584738144923000978
531703538711807700576039477845919760337776974643033245562952408346982160326796976455887641174934841999503108148695729474129821323486419094985920265322028689526515873714176
656316063457037458775617002684835152426299117909712305581834574586570709008582251294904959560332084787889696952576
1000010000101000101111110110111111000110001011011100100111100110110111110100010101101000101011001010000111111010011100001111001111110010101101010001111000011000100001111111011010000010010000
1020505766770613344746676425505312077234171762552170304177320220